According to the biologists who entered cats as “invasive alien species No. 1,787,” onto the Institute of Nature Conservation list, “’felis catus’ was domesticated probably around 10,000 years ago in the cradle of the great civilizations of the ancient Middle East, making the species alien to Europe from a strictly scientific point of view.” However, just because there aren’t any witnesses still around who remember when and where their UFO landed on Earth, doesn’t mean cats are not from Mars, or at least that’s my theory as a renowned Dog Ufologist.

Well according to lead biologist in this study, Wojciech Solarz, “the cat 100% met all criteria to land itself on the list of invasive species due to the animals’ harmful impact on biodiversity.” See! I told you, cats are a menace to society! Solarz went on to explain in an interview that “cats kill 140 million birds in Poland every year.” This startling figure doesn’t even include the mammals cats also hunt.

However, before you go running in fear from cats, the researchers at the Polish Academy of Sciences believe we can peacefully coexist. We just need to limit their time outdoors.
